Why go

Seolbong Oncheon Land in Icheon, Gyeonggi-do, is a large public hot-spring (oncheon) complex set at the base of Seolbong Mountain, one of Gyeonggi Province's most-cited hot-spring destinations for day-trip visitors from Seoul. The complex combines multiple gender-segregated indoor baths (fresh oncheon water with dissolved bicarbonate and mineral content, drawn from a working well on site), themed pools (herbal, mugwort, jade-stone), an outdoor bade-pool section, a jjimjilbang (Korean spa lounge with heated stone rooms), and a supporting restaurant-and-rest complex. Icheon has been Korea's traditional ceramics-production center for centuries and hosts the biennial Icheon Ceramics Festival, so most visitors combine the oncheon visit with the surrounding Icheon Ceramics Village and the Seolbong Park cultural cluster (including the Icheon World Ceramic Center — a major public ceramics museum). Standard oncheon admission typically runs KRW 10,000-15,000 for day-use; jjimjilbang add-on usually adds KRW 3,000-5,000. Allow 3-4 hours for a leisurely oncheon + jjimjilbang combination. Access: about 1 hour from Seoul by car, or via Icheon KTX Station (30 minutes from Suseo Station). Best paired with the Icheon Ceramics Village for a full Icheon cultural-and-oncheon day, or with the Seolbong Park + Icheon World Ceramic Center cluster.
